The demand for garlic in the Philippines exceeds its current production capacity, leading to a shortage of garlic in the market. To address this issue, it is essential to explore potential solutions such as growing garlic during the off-season under a protective structure. One of the major components of this kind of technology is to optimize soil media (M1 - 1kg CRH: compost mixture/sqm, M2 - 10kg CRH: compost mixture/sqm, M3 - 20kg CRH: compost mixture/sqm) and planting density (D1 - 5x5cm, D2 - 10x10cm, D3 - 15x15cm) to enhance soil fertility and crop productivity. In light of this, a study was conducted at the Greenhouse Facility (16°43'38.0’’N 120°23’12.4’’E) of the College of Agriculture at Don Mariano Marcos Memorial State University North La Union Campus, Sapilang, Bacnotan, La Union from January to April 2022. The objective was to determine the effect of soil media, planting density, and the interaction between soil media and planting density on garlic yield under protective structure. The experimental design employed was a split-plot design in a randomized complete block design (RCBD) with three blocks. The findings of the study revealed that garlic plants grown in soil applied with a 10 kg CRH: compost mixture exhibited the highest number of leaves, tallest plant height, widest bulb diameter, the greatest number of cloves, and the highest yield per plot. No significant differences observed on planting density and the interaction of planting density and soil media.
